Abstract


In “The Adventures of Tintin” a float plane is used to fly across the desert, however, it runs low on fuel. In this paper, we use a similar model plane (Piper PA-18) to determine the plane’s overall energy efficiency given that it was refueled using a belch. We found the efficiency of the plane engine to be 0.814 % based on the fuel of choice being ethanol vapour and only a small amount (0.280 kg), which produced an energy of 1.93 kJ to keep the plane flying for a short period of time.
